JOB DESCRIPTION:
The CT Technologist I demonstrates knowledge and sense of responsibility in the daily operations of the CT department. They operate a variety of CT equipment to perform CT exams according to established practices under the direction of a Radiologist, Supervisor, and Lead Technologists, utilizing ionizing radiation. The CT technologist I is expected to provide support to Radiography students, new technologists and other hospital personnel as needed. May be required to work a variety of shifts, weekends, holidays, and take call on a rotational basis.
EDUCATION: Graduate of an accredited school of radiologic technology approved by CAHEA/JERCT. Certified by the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) or the Nuclear Medicine Technology Certification Board (NMTCB).
EXPERIENCE: Less than one year of experience as a Radiologic Technologist or CT Technologist.
